Touchscreen at a glance:
Login/Logout & Driver IDPress this button to login. Once
logged in, your Driver ID will display above the button.
Panic ButtonPress & Hold to send emergency notification to your administrator.
HOS Duty Status (DOT)Press the button to change your
duty status.
Dim ButtonPress the button to change the unit’s brightness settings.
System ApplicationsCheck HOS Logs, Set Work Alone Timer and more.
Posted Speed LimitThis area will display the
vehicle’s speed and the posted speed limit.
On/Off Road ButtonPress this button to toggle
between On/Off Road for IFTA reporting.
GPS StatusSatellite icon indicates good GPS lock.
LAW ENFORCEMENT OPERATING INSTRUCTIONS:
In the event of a system failure:
In the event the system fails, trucks are equipped with a blank log book•Drivers have been instructed to record that the system failed, the date and •time of the failure, and to recreate the last 7 days logs at their next change of status locationRecreated logs may consist of both printed and paper logs•Electronic logs can be emailed or faxed to your location•

Driver Log In:Press 1. LOGIN button (see image 1)
Enter your Driver ID, press 2. OK (see image 2)
Press 3. SAVE to complete login
Driver Log Out:Press 1. LOGOUT button (see image 3)
“You will be logged out as the driver” 2. message will display, Press OK You are now logged out.
Work Alone Timer:Press 1. WORK ALONE menu option (see image 19)
Enter the amount of time, in minutes, 2. you plan on working away from the vehicle (see image 20)
Press 3. START. The display will return to the home screen, however the timer will continue to run in the background
> Before time expires, you have 3 options:
CHECK IN:• use this option if you need more time to work
STOP:• use this option to stop the timer if you have finished your work
DRIVE:• if the vehicle moves prior to time expiring, the timer will be cancelled

DOT Drivers Only
Driver Log In:Press 1. LOGIN button (see image 4)
Enter you Driver ID, press 2. OK
Press 3. NExT
Select 4. YES or NO for personal use, then press NExT (see image 5)
(Optional) Enter Load information, 5. then press NExT (see image 6)
Select 6. YES or NO to record a pre-trip inspection, then press NExT
Review Login Summary information, 7. press DONE to complete the login Your duty status will be set to “On Duty - Not Driving”
Text Messages:Press 1. MESSAGES menu option (see image 17)
Select either 2. CREATE or PREDEFINED
> If you select CREATE:
Type your message, press • SEND (see image 18)
> If you select PREDEFINED:
Choose a message from the list, then 1. press SELECT
Press 2. SEND Your message will be sent to the inthinc portal for an administrator to review.

DOT Drivers Only
Change HOS Status:Press 1. HOS STATUS button (see image 7)
Select 2. YES or NO for Personal Use
> If NO for Personal Use:
Select the most appropriate duty •status from the list, then press SAVE (see image 8) NOTE: If you select “Can’t Continue” as the duty status, you will need to press the REASON button, and select the reason for not continuing from the list.
> If YES for Personal Use:
Press • SAVE
DOT Drivers Only
Driver Log Out: Press 1. LOGOUT button (see image 14)
Select the most appropriate duty 2. status from the list, press OK (see image 15)
“You will be logged out as the driver” 3. message will display, press OK
Select 4. YES or NO to record a post-trip inspection (see image 16)
If you selected NO, confirm your 5. selection and press OK You are now logged out.

DOT Drivers Only
View HOS Logs: Press 1. HOS LOG menu button (see image 9)
Use the 2. FORWARD/BACK buttons to scroll through all days in the log
Use the 3. UP/DOWN arrows to scroll through all of the log data (for example, Driver ID, HOS Ruleset, Time Remaining, etc.)
Press 4. OK to exit the application
DOT Drivers Only
Check Hours: Press 1. CHECK HOURS menu button (see image 11)
Press anywhere in the Driver ID field, 2. when the keypad displays, enter the DRIVER ID (see image 12)
Press 3. CHECK The system will retrieve the remaining “On Duty” and “Driving” time for the Driver ID entered. (see image 13)
